Baseflight固件压缩包内容详解
需积分: 5 129 浏览量
更新于2024-10-01
收藏 2.03MB RAR 举报
资源摘要信息:"Baseflight是一个开源的飞控软件,主要用于多旋翼无人机(multirotor UAVs),它允许用户通过简单的硬件配置和参数调整,实现飞行控制功能。Baseflight拥有一个图形用户界面(GUI)和一个命令行界面(CLI),可以支持多种类型的飞行控制器。Baseflight是由Michael Oborne在2012年左右开发,并迅速成为多旋翼无人机领域中广泛使用的软件之一。随着技术的发展,Baseflight的代码库后来成为其他一些流行飞控软件的基础,比如Cleanflight和Betaflight。
Baseflight的特性包括:
1. 高度的可定制性:Baseflight允许用户调整PID控制参数,这直接影响到无人机的稳定性和响应性。
2. 快速的反应时间:这个软件为用户提供低延迟的控制体验,这对于精确的飞行控制来说至关重要。
3. 高级功能:支持多种传感器和飞行模式,包括飞行器稳定模式、姿态保持模式等。
4. 易于使用:尽管Baseflight功能强大,但其用户界面设计得相对直观,新手可以通过图形界面进行基本的调整。
Baseflight在发展过程中,促进了飞行控制技术的革新,推动了开源无人机硬件和软件的发展。它为后来的Cleanflight和Betaflight等软件提供了基础,这些软件进一步提高了性能、增加了新特性和优化了用户体验。"
【注】以上信息均以标题、描述和标签中的"baseflight.rar"为基准进行的知识点总结。由于文件中未提供具体的文件名称列表,无法针对性地提供关于"baseflight"压缩文件包内的具体内容分析。如果存在具体的文件列表,可能会涉及到更具体的软件版本信息、配置文件、代码文件等相关内容。
2021-08-10 上传
2016-04-19 上传
2017-07-30 上传
2021-07-03 上传
2021-07-10 上传
2021-06-13 上传
2021-06-13 上传
2021-05-24 上传
m0_70960708
- 粉丝: 643
- 资源: 2860
最新资源
- Linux系统指令大全.pdf
- 深入浅出Struts2.pdf
- Pro Ado.net Data Services
- vim中文用户手册 学习vi
- 基于单片机的智能台灯设计与制作
- Serial Port Complete 2nd 英文版 PDF
- fedora中文版安装及配置常见问题解答
- fedora 10安装指南
- ARM Manual (ARM英文操作手册)2
- The Verilog Hardware Description Language 5th Edition
- vb图书管理系统论文
- more effective C++
- Struts in Action 中文版
- MFC程序中类之间变量的互相访问
- 带串行口通信汉字点阵屏的研究与实现
- 先进算法讲义——中科大